Flowserve Co. (NYSE:FLS) operates within the industrial products sector, specializing in manufacturing and distributing flow control equipment. The company’s portfolio includes pumps, valves, and mechanical seals used across various industries, such as oil and gas, power generation, and chemical processing. Flowserve’s Role in the Industrial Sector

Flowserve Co. designs and delivers flow management solutions for industries requiring precision-engineered equipment. Its products are widely used in energy, water management, and industrial processing applications. The company’s extensive global presence and diverse product range contribute to its role in critical infrastructure projects.

As part of its operations, Flowserve Co. continues to focus on product innovation and service expansion. The company works with various industries to provide tailored solutions that enhance efficiency and operational reliability.
